DFID’s UK Aid Connect Program: Creating Innovative Solutions to Change Poor People’s Lives

Sexual and Reproductive Health and Rights Program in Mozambique

Deadline for Phase 1: 15 September 2017

Deadline for Phase 2: 20 October 2017

The Department for International Development (DFID) is seeking proposals for its “UK Aid Connect” program to support consortia to create innovative solutions to complex development challenges that deliver real change to poor people’s lives.

There is a growing recognition that the problems facing the poorest most excluded people and the global challenges underlying those problems, are complex and interconnected. No single development actor has all the answers. Coalitions and collaboration bring new and creative ideas, innovation, better results and opportunities through pooled ideas, skills and resources.
